Direct Edge, the third largest stock exchange operator in the United States, announces EdgeBook DepthSM, a product providing full depth of book information from Direct Edge's EDGA Exchange, Inc.SM and EDGX Exchange, Inc.SM, is now available through Interactive Data Corporation's Consolidated Feed.
EDGA and EDGX together serve as the transaction venue for more than 11 percent of U.S. cash equities trading1 and comprise the top exchange destination for retail order flow from the largest discount brokerage houses.

The Interactive Data Consolidated Feed delivers low latency data from more than 450 sources worldwide. The sources in the Consolidated Feed cover more than 150 exchanges, 110 contributors of OTC data and include multi-asset class instrument coverage and extensive Level 2 data. The feed is used by financial institutions globally to power algorithmic and electronic trading applications.
